About 701 Pennsylvania Ave #1105

Welcome yourself to the prominent neoclassical condominium tower at the Residences at Market Square East in the Penn Quarter neighborhood. Perfectly positioned equidistant between the U.S. Capitol and the White House, it forms half of a twin-building complex known for its curvilinear design and proximity to the National Mall and the Archives Metro station. This 11th floor 1 bedoom 1 bath condo is open concept. The living room has floor-to-ceiling windows to let the light just stream in. The kitchen has an electric range, microwave, fridge, and dishwasher. The kitchen opens to the living room with a bar perfect for stools or a dining table. Glass double doors open to the bedroom that will fit up to a king-size bed. A dressing hallway has a mirrored double closet and a linen closet. It opens to the bathroom with a shower and tub. The bathroom has a second entry perfect for guests. In-unit Washer & Dryer. The living room opens up to the nicely sized balcony with expansive city views. The living and bedrooms have warm carpeting. The building is rich with amenities, and offers an outdoor pool (Memorial Day to Labor Day), Gym and a 24-hour front desk.
